#199cc8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#199cc8 is composed of 9.8% red, 61.2% green and 78.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87.5% cyan, 22% magenta, 0% yellow and 21.6% black. It has a hue angle of 195.1 degrees, a saturation of 77.8% and a lightness of 44.1%. #199cc8 color hex could be obtained by blending #32ffff with #003991. Closest websafe color is: #0099cc.

Shades and Tints of #199cc8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010608 is the darkest color, while #f6fcf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#199cc8

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#707171 is the less saturated color, while #08a5d9 is the most saturated one.
